The Circular Fashion Federation presented its first manifesto, aimed at making the European fashion sector more sustainable, at an event in Brussels on Thursday.
The five-point roadmap, designed to counter “fast fashion,” seeks to align extended product lifespan with competitiveness.
Established in France in April 2022, the federation now includes 300 members across the continent, including Vinted and Veepee. It brings together various stakeholders from the circular economy to identify needs and develop solutions.
After several exchanges with the European Commission, the manifesto outlines five key principles to enhance health, the environment, labour conditions, and performance in this highly competitive sector.
The first focus is on competitiveness, enabling European nations to compete with exporting countries by revising customs duties.
The second lever is taxation, primarily reducing VAT on more sustainable products.
The third pivot is the influence of consumers, since their choices shape the market.
Harmonious management of the fabric's end-of-life process - when it is too worn to be worn - is the fourth focus.
Lastly, supporting collection, sorting, reuse, and recycling actors and funding innovations is essential to complete the circular fashion cycle, the Federation notes.
The textile sector, one of the most polluting industries, produces over 110 million tonnes of fabric annually. Since the 1990s, low-cost, poor-quality models have replaced the traditional autumn-winter and spring-summer collections.
Circular fashion challenges “fast fashion” by promoting the production of higher-quality garments and planning their end-of-life stages.
Is the circular fashion movement destined to fail? Not necessarily. “If we succeed, in five years we will have achieved greater circularity: more reuse, repair, and recycling,” said Maxime Delavallée, President of the Circular Fashion Federation.
